Party above all
Akbar Road is one of the most gracious avenues of Lutyen8217;s Delhi. However, the peace of the tranquil neighborhood, with its colonial bungalows and large lawns, is frequently disturbed by the noise emanating from Bungalow No 24, the headquarters of the Congress party. Ticket-seekers, hangers-on, demonstrators gather there and spill on to the roads. They park their cars wherever they can. Now, the neighbours have an even bigger grouse. The municipal authorities have started dismantling the 20-foot wide grassy sidewalk to make way for a parking lot. All for the convenience of a political party?
Speaking for Singh
Apart from the official media spokespersons, it is common practice in the BJP for senior leaders to retain an unofficial spokesperson who conveys his bosses8217; viewpoint to select journalists. For instance, Rajnath Singh, who does not unwind easily with the media, has appointed a college lecturer from his inner coterie for the job. When Singh was agriculture minister in the Vajpayee government, the unofficial spokesperson moved from Lucknow to Delhi and joined his ministry. Now that Singh is BJP president , the same gentleman has been given office space at the party headquarters at 11 Ashoka Road.
The unofficial spokesperson has been active in conveying his master8217;s viewpoint on the recent organisational changes in the party, which has caused much heartburn. He has gone out of his way to confirm that the re-organisation was a snub to Singh8217;s rivals Arun Jaitley and Narendra Modi, and that the RSS leadership was kept in the picture. However, since Singh was appointed specifically with the agenda of ending factionalism in the BJP, it was expected that the spokesperson would try to smooth over differences with rival groups rather than ruffle more feathers.

Quote, misquote
Media reports suggesting that the organisers of the recent Satyagraha centenary conference in Delhi goofed up so badly that Sonia Gandhi had to pull them up for making former Zambian president Kenneth Kaunda travel in a bus like an ordinary delegate are without foundation. In fact, Kaunda was provided a Mercedes for his stay in New Delhi and former DUSU president Ragini Naik was designated as his escort.
When Sonia Gandhi was seeing off delegates after the inaugural session at Vigyan Bhavan, she turned to the chief organiser Anand Sharma and inquired if Kaunda would be able to reach Hyderabad House 8212; where lunch was being hosted 8212; in time since ordinary cars were not being allowed at the Vigyan Bhavan VVIP gate. Sharma had then asked Kaunda to travel in his own limousine.
A senior Congress worker misheard the conversation and gave a totally different spin of the incident to newspersons. The idea was to show up Sharma in a poor light, what with some Congress activists being aggrieved that they were kept out of the show.
